  3. CBSSports' Matt Zenitz is reporting that Lane Kiffin will retain edge rushers coach Kevin Peoples. Why is this significant? There were whispers that LSU would target, or at least have communications with LaAllen Clark for their edge position. Clark is a native of Baton Rouge. Clark was signed last year and just helped the Texas Longhorns pass rushers put up major numbers in 2025. Texas, as a defense, currently ranks 3rd in the country with 38.0 sacks this season.
